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 1 cup fresh strawberries (or frozen, thawed)
  • ½ cup heavy cream
  • 1 cup white chocolate (chopped or chips)
  • 1 tbsp unsalted butter (optional, for extra silkiness)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ract (optional, for added depth of flavor)
  • 1 tablespoon honey or powdered sugar (optional, for added sweetness).

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Prepare the Strawberries

  1. Wash and hull fresh strawberries.
  2. Blend them into a smooth puree using a food processor or blender.
  3. Strain the puree through a fine-mesh sieve to remove seeds for an ultra-smooth ganache.

2. Heat the Cream

  1. In a small saucepan, warm the heavy cream over medium heat until it begins to simmer.
  2. Avoid boiling, as overheating can affect the consistency.

3. Melt the Chocolate

  1. Add the chopped white chocolate to a heatproof bowl.
  2. Pour the warm cream over the chocolate and let it sit for a minute.
  3. Stir gently until the chocolate melts and blends smoothly with the cream.

4. Add the Strawberry Puree

  1. Gradually mix in the strained strawberry puree.
  2. Stir until well incorporated, creating a luscious pink ganache.

5. Final Touches

  1. Add butter for extra shine and smoothness.
  2. Mix in vanilla extract for enhanced flavor.
  3. Add honey or powdered sugar if a sweeter taste is desired.
  4. Let the ganache cool slightly before use.

How to Use Strawberry Ganache

  • Cake Drizzle: Pour over cakes for a glossy, elegant finish.
  • Macaron Filling: Use as a creamy filling for a fruity touch.
  • Cupcake Topping: Pipe onto cupcakes for a stunning presentation.
  • Dip for Fruits: Serve as a dip for strawberries, bananas, or marshmallows.
  • Layer in Desserts: Swirl into cheesecakes or trifles for added flavor.
  • Chocolate-Covered Strawberries: Dip strawberries in ganache and let them set for a decadent treat.
  • Mousse Base: Mix with whipped cream for a light and airy mousse.

Tips for the Perfect Ganache

  • Use High-Quality White Chocolate – Ensures a smooth and rich texture.
  • Adjust Thickness – Add more chocolate for a thicker consistency or more cream for a thinner glaze.
  • Strain the Puree – Removes seeds for a flawless finish.
  • Chill Before Piping – Refrigerate for 30 minutes if using as a filling.
  • Proper Storage – Refrigerate in an airtight container for up to one week.
  • Experiment with Flavors – Add a splash of citrus juice or zest for an extra depth of flavor.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I Substitute White Chocolate with Milk or Dark Chocolate?

Yes! White chocolate keeps the vibrant strawberry color, but milk or dark chocolate will create a deeper, richer ganache.

2. How Can I Make It Dairy-Free?

Substitute heavy cream with coconut cream and use dairy-free white chocolate.

3. Can I Substitute Fresh Strawberries with Freeze-Dried Strawberries?

Absolutely! Grind freeze-dried strawberries into a fine powder and mix directly into the ganache.

4. How Do I Fix a Too-Thin Ganache?

Add more melted white chocolate to thicken the mixture.

5. Can I Make This Ahead of Time?

Yes! Store in the fridge and gently reheat before using.

6. How Long Does Strawberry Ganache Last?

It can last up to a week in the fridge when stored in an airtight container. To store it longer, freeze for up to two months.

7. Can I Use This Ganache for Piping?

Yes! Simply chill it in the fridge for 30 minutes to firm up before transferring it to a piping bag.

8. How Can I Make the Ganache Thicker for Truffles?

Use a higher ratio of chocolate to cream (2:1) and refrigerate until firm enough to scoop and roll into truffles.
